In response to the outbreak, Turkish Philanthropy Funds has launched the TPF COVID-19 Community Relief Fund to support containment, response, and recovery activities for those affected and for the responders.
Turkish Philanthropy Funds has worked with donors and partners on the ground to understand the effects of COVID-19 on communities and respond immediately. TPF's goal has been to support containment, response, and recovery activities for those affected and for the responders.
Until today, with the generous supports of our donors, 17 NGOs based in Turkey and in the US, have received grants in the amount of $230,184.88. These valuable donations are being used to support vulnerable communities as well as purchase protective supplies, among other needs. With our donors' gifts, we could provide necessary protective equipment for doctors and medical staff. Together, we could help children and their families have access to healthy food and hygiene kits. Children had laptops and access to the internet to be able to continue their education.
